Avoid These Rip-Offs: Product Red Flags in Nigeria
You need to be savvy when shopping in Nigeria. Lots of sellers are out there trying to take advantage unsuspecting buyers Scam product with dubious products. Don't let yourself become a sucker. Here are some warning signs to watch out for:
- Too good to be true deals: If something seems unbelievably cheap, it probably is. Fraudsters often use low prices to lure in buyers.
- Unprofessional stores: Avoid businesses that look messy. Check online reviews and ask family for advice
- Low quality products: Examine the goods carefully for cracks. Ask questions about the components used.
Be vigilant and don't be afraid to walk away from a deal that feels dodgy. Your safety and your cash are worth it.

Citizens of Nigeria Consumers Beware: The Dangers of Bad Products
The market can be flooded with products, some of which may be substandard and bring serious risks to our health and safety. It becomes vital for consumers learn how to identify recognize these bad goods before they make a purchase.
Let's some key signs to pay attention for:
- Badly made items with rough edges or poor quality materials.
- Past-due products that might be harmful to your health.
- False labeling that hide the true contents of a product.
With these tips, you are able to avoid purchasing bad goods and ensure your health and safety.
Remember, it is always best to purchase at reputable sellers and offer warranties.
